Excerpt from The Code of the City of Atlanta: Containing the Charter of 1874, and the Amendments Thereto, Certain Other Laws of the State, the Ordinances Adopted by the Mayor and General Council Sec. 7. Except as the laws may be changed or modified by the laws and charter of the City of Atlanta, said city shall succeed to and pre serve and carry out all the rights Of West End, whether they exist by reason of contract or otherwise. And especially will Atlanta preserve to the citizens Of the Seventh ward all the rights that the citizens of the city of West End now have as to street-railway franchises, grants or conditional grants, and in enforcing any contract or lien received from the city of West End under this contract, the City, of Atlanta shall have and exercise all the rights and-remedies that the city of West End or its citizens had, or may have had; and, in addition, the said City of Atlanta shall have all the rights and remedies which West End now has to enforce said contracts or liens so received; this power to apply to executions for taxes and assessments for local improve ments of any kind.
